Found in the heart of Central Ryde, this excitingly individual terraced townhouse offers a unique blend of character and modern living. Originally a brewery, this historic property has been thoughtfully converted, preserving original features that add charm and a sense of history to the home. Spanning an impressive 914 square feet, the accommodation is spread over three floors, providing ample space for comfortable living.
Upon entering, you are greeted by a generous entrance hall measuring 20'4, which sets a welcoming tone for the rest of the home. The ground floor features a cosy reception room, perfect for entertaining or relaxing with family. The south-facing courtyard garden is easily accessible from this lounge, providing a delightful outdoor space to enjoy the sunshine.
The property boasts two well-proportioned bedrooms and two bathrooms, making it ideal for families or those seeking extra space. The top floor is particularly striking, with vaulted ceilings that create a stylish atmosphere in the kitchen/diner. Here, you can enjoy lovely views of the sea, making it a perfect spot for dining or unwinding.
Convenience is key, as this home is located just yards from public transport links, including buses and trains, and is within walking distance of the beach and town centre. Additionally, there is parking available for one vehicle, adding to the practicality of this charming property.
This terraced townhouse is a rare find, combining historical charm with modern amenities in a prime location. It is an ideal choice for anyone looking to embrace the vibrant lifestyle that this coastal town of Ryde has to offer.
